Huasun claims 23.30% efficiency, 723.97 W output for utility-scale solar panels

Huasun’s new PV modules have an open-circuit voltage of 49.46 V, a short-circuit current of 17.57 A, and a fill factor of 83.29%. Germany’s TÜV SUD has confirmed the results.

Midsummer develops 24.9% efficient 4T tandem perovskite-CIGS solar cell

Midsummer and researchers from the University of California, Los Angeles (UCLA), say that their new tandem PV cell is suitable for the company’s Duo production equipment, which makes 56 mm x 156 mm CIGS cells on a flexible stainless steel substrate.

Light redirecting film to improve heterojunction solar module performance

Finnish technology company Intelligent Control Systems has conceived a light redirecting film that purportedly reduces energy losses in the edge area of heterojunction solar cells. It claims the film may increase the power conversion efficiency of a heterojunction module by up to 0.75%.

Kesterite solar cell with transparent electrode achieves 11.4% efficiency

Chinese researchers fabricated a kesterite PV device using a transparent fluorine-doped tin oxide (FTO) substrate instead of substrates based on opaque Mo-coated soda lime glass. The cell has an open-circuit voltage of 0.522 V, a short-circuit current of 33.0 mA cm−2, and a fill factor of 68.55%.
